home *** CD-ROM | disk | FTP | other *** search
/ Amiga Elysian Archive / AmigaElysianArchive.iso / emulate / macflopy.lzh / MacFlopy.doc
Text File  |  1991-04-14  |  3KB  |  70 lines

  1. I. To build the interface, you will need:
  2.  
  3. 1 - 74LS139 Dual 2 to 4 line converter  !USE LS TYPE! Don't use HCT etc.!!!
  4. 1 - 74LS393 Dual 4-bit binary counter        !SUBSTITUTES NOT ALLOWED!
  5. 2 - 1N4148 small signal diodes
  6. 1 - DB23 Male (To Amiga)
  7. 1 - DB23 Female (To external drive)
  8. 1 - DB19 Female (To Mac Drive)
  9. 1 - Box (Radio Shack #270-230)
  10.     Wire, perf board etc.
  11.  
  12.  
  13. II. Signal Lines:
  14.  
  15.   ------------------                          -------------------      
  16.   DB-23 Male (Amiga)                           DB-19 Female (Mac)
  17.   ------------------                          -------------------      
  18.  
  19. 1  Ready/         13 Side/                  1  Gnd          11 PH0
  20. 2  Read Data/     14 Write Prot./           2  Gnd          12 PH1
  21. 3  Gnd            15 Track 0/               3  Gnd          13 PH2
  22. 4  Gnd            16 Write Enable/          4  Gnd          14 PH3
  23. 5  Gnd            17 Write Data/            5  gnd (-12v)   15 Wreq
  24. 6  Gnd            18 Step/                  6  +5 volts     16 HD sel
  25. 7  Gnd            19 Dir                    7  +12 Volts    17 Enable2
  26. 8  Motor On/      20 Sel 3/                 8  +12 Volts    18 RD
  27. 9  Sel 2/         21 Sel 1/                 9  NC           19 WD
  28. 10 Reset/         22 Index/                 10 PWM (nc)
  29. 11 Change/        23 +12 Volts
  30. 12 +5 volts
  31.  
  32.    *** Consult the picture when building this project, as it contains  ***
  33.                   information not present in this file! 
  34.  
  35. III. SIMPLIFIED Procedure:
  36.  
  37. Cut  holes in the project case for the connectors.  I put the DB23's on the
  38. ends  and  the mounted the DB19 on the "bottom" of the case.  Thus what was
  39. the top now became the bottom.  If you align the connectors just right, you
  40. will  be  able  to  slide the interface into the computer without having to
  41. lift  either  the  interface  or  the  computer.   I  put some small rubber
  42. stick-on feet on the aluminum cover near the screws to act as feet.
  43.  
  44. You  can  make  the interface single ended or with the pass-through for the
  45. external  drive.   When  wiring  up  with  the  pass-through, note that all
  46. signals  are connected between both Amiga connectors, except for the select
  47. lines.   These  lines  are  moved  over  by one.  The SEL1 line goes to the
  48. interface circuitry, and the other select lines are moved to the next lower
  49. logical  line  on  the  pass through connector.  IE SEL2 Amiga goes to SEL1
  50. external etc.  SEL3 is not connected.
  51.  
  52. If you decide that you don't want or need the pass-through, you may need to
  53. add  1k  ohm pull up resistors on the signal lines of the DB-19 (pins 11 to
  54. 19)  in  order to get reliable operation.  Wire the resistors with one lead
  55. connected to the signal line, and the other connected to the +5v supply.
  56.  
  57. Almost  any  construction techniques will work, although I generally prefer
  58. point  to point soldering on the perf boards with copper pads when building
  59. small  projects.   Use  a  fine wire such as wire wrap wire, and check your
  60. work!
  61.  
  62. IV. A few notes....
  63.  
  64. REMEMBER!   If  you  are adding this to your Amiga 1010 drive, the +12 V is
  65. NOT  passed  through  by  the  A1010.   You must modify the drive to do so.
  66. Verify  that  your  particular  drive(s)  passes  all lines by testing this
  67. interface  at  the computer and on the end of your daisy chain of drive(s).
  68. If it fails on the end of the drive, and not on the computer, then you need
  69. to trace the drives signal wires to find what line(s) are missing.
  70.